EXCLUSIVE: With 2 new series, Person of Interest and Alcatraz, one returning, Fringe, and a Star Trek movie sequel on his plate, it wasn’t clear whether J.J. Abrams would be developing this year. He did and the result, a drama written by Supernatural creator/executive producer Eric Kripke, has gotten a pilot production commitment from NBC. Like most things JJ, details about the project titled Revolution are being kept under wraps but it’s being described as an epic adventure thriller. It hails from Abrams’ Bad Robot production company and Warner Bros. TV where the company is based. Abrams, Kripke and Bryan Burk are executive producing.
This is the second high-profile project for WME-repped Kripke this season. He also is writing/executive producing an adaptation of the DC Comic Deadman for the CW and WBTV. http://www.deadline.com/2011/09/jj-a...itment-at-nbc/ |
